A study published in The American Journal Of Clinical Nutrition found that high-dose vitamin A supplementation modestly improved the linear growth of preschool Indonesian children, particularly those with low serum retinol levels. This highlights the critical role vitamin A plays in body development (1). Vitamin A in its pure form is found in foods such as meat, full-fat dairy products, eggs, and fortified breakfast cereals. Vitamin A can also be obtained in its preformed version as carotenoids that are found in orange, red, and yellow vegetables such as carrots, sweet potatoes, winter squash, and peppers, and in dark leafy greens where the green chlorophyll masks those same orange, red, and yellow carotenoids. Vitamin A-rich fruits include apricots, mangoes, peaches, and papaya.

A study published in the Nutrients journal found that vitamin D deficiency impaired growth (height) in young Japanese children by 0.6 cm per year. This emphasizes the importance of ensuring adequate vitamin D levels to support healthy growth (2).

Lack of adequate vitamin D in childhood can cause rickets, characterized by softening of the bones leading to poor growth and development. Ensure your child has adequate vitamin D in their diet by providing foods such as salmon, trout, sardines, fortified dairy milk, fortified soy milk, mushrooms, eggs and cheese.

A study published in the British Journal Of Nutrition found that North Indian children with suboptimal Vitamin B12 levels showed limited growth. The study determined that supplementation with Vitamin B12 led to an improvement in height (3). This underscores the importance of ensuring sufficient Vitamin B12 intake for optimal growth. A study published in the Scientific Reports journal investigated the associations of calcium intake with height growth in adolescents. Researchers found that higher calcium intake during adolescence is associated with faster height growth, particularly in boys with plant-based diets. The study showed that boys who consumed over 327 mg of calcium per day had faster height growth compared to those with lower calcium intakes. This highlights the importance of ensuring adequate calcium intake, especially for children who may have limited access to dairy products, to support their bone development and overall growth (6).

Research published in the Journal Of King Saud University determined that magnesium helps regulate the activity of parathyroid hormone that may influence calcium absorption and bone health. Additionally, magnesium supports the function of osteoblasts (cells responsible for bone formation) and chondrocytes (cells involved in cartilage development), ultimately contributing to bone elongation and remodeling, particularly in children during their growth periods (7).

In fact, a study published in the Pediatrics Report journal found that zinc supplementation significantly enhanced growth in school-aged Thai children. Researchers found that children who received zinc supplementation over a 6-month period had a greater increase in height compared to those in the placebo group (8).

Research suggests that boron can play an essential role in calcium metabolism and bone health by influencing osteoblast activity and boosting serum calcium levels. Researchers found that boron supplementation was linked to improved bone strength and better calcium utilization, potentially enhancing the benefits of vitamin D in supporting calcium absorption (9). Caution: These minerals and vitamins for height play an effective role in aiding growth when incorporated into a balanced diet. However, if you substitute them with supplements, you may face potential side effects. Overuse of height-increasing supplements can cause hormonal imbalances, digestive issues like bloating and nausea, joint pain, or even allergic reactions. Excessive intake can overstimulate the body, leading to anxiety or sleep disturbances, and might interfere with other medications. Always consult a healthcare provider before using supplements to ensure safe and effective usage.

The Role Of Age In Height Growth

Age is an important factor in determining the growth of children. Growth occurs gradually during the childhood period. During puberty, aka the ‘growth spurt period’, both boys and girls grow quickly. Therefore, parents must ensure that they include foods rich in minerals and vitamins during this time in their children’s diet. Once the puberty period ends, the bones stop growing, setting one’s height in stone. So, ensuring proper nutrition, good sleep, and adequate physical activities are crucial during the puberty phase for the complete development of children.
